Unveiled a year after the Stradale, the Ferrari SF90 Spider transformed Maranello's first series-production plug-in-hybrid flagship into open-air form, pairing a retractable hardtop with hypercar output. Its powertrain combined a 4.0-liter, twin-turbo V8 and three e-motors for a quoted 1000 CV, deployed through an eight-speed dual-clutch and an electrically driven front axle for seamless all-wheel traction. In qualifying mode, it delivered numbers that redefined road-car pace, with 100 km/h flashing by in 2.5 seconds and a top speed of 340 km/h. The Spider specification retained these otherworldly performance figures while adding alfresco drama.
Neatly finished in Verde Zeltweg with a Cuoio leather and Alcantara interior, this 2024 Ferrari SF90 Spider, chassis number 304179, presents a well-considered specification that sets it apart from the vast majority of its contemporaries-ordered red or laden with contrasting colors and carbon accents. Here, the palette is sophisticated and the options are purposeful. Diamond-polished forged wheels are secured by titanium wheel stud bolts, complemented by glossy black brake calipers behind the spokes. Black tailpipe tips adorn the rear. Inside, the cabin mixes Cuoio Alcantara perforated inserts on the dashboard and door panels with Cuoio leather trimming the ventilated and fully electric Daytona-style seats. Technology and amenities are equally well considered; Apple CarPlay handles infotainment, while the parking camera, front and rear parking sensors, electrochromic rear-view mirror, suspension lifter, and AFS adaptive headlight system vastly improve daily usability.
Chassis 304179 was delivered new to official Ferrari dealer Kroymans Automotive B.V. in the Netherlands and remains in virtually as-delivered condition with fewer than 450 kilometers recorded at cataloging. The car is offered from its first and only owner, a Ferrari devotee whose approach to specification reflects a lifetime of considered collector taste. In the 1990s, he commissioned a Ferrari F355 GTS with a manual gearbox in dark green over Cuoio-a car he has never parted with-and the SF90 Spider was ordered with the same specification, pairing Verde Zeltweg with Cuoio to equally refined effect. From new, the two Ferraris have shared the same collection, the SF90 spending its entire life alongside the F355 it was deliberately configured to mirror. It is offered now simply as a consequence of its owner's age, and is accompanied by its owner's manuals, two keys, charging cable, tools, tire inflator, and car cover.
